What Is CISCO-UNIFIED-COMPUTING-PROCESSOR-MIB?

CISCO-UNIFIED-COMPUTING-PROCESSOR-MIB is a Cisco Systems proprietary MIB representing the PROCESSOR management-information package within Cisco UCS Manager. Its processor-core table records instance ID and distinguished/relative name per CPU core, while an environmental-statistics table records input current (current/average/max/min), sample-interval count, a suspect flag, temperature (current/average/max/min), thresholded flag, time collected, and an update trigger, alongside a historical-statistics table. As a hardware/performance-status MIB it lets a UCS administrator watch a processor's temperature and input-current trend to catch thermal or power problems. Monitoring Examples

A UCS administrator monitors cucsProcessorEnvStatsTemperature against TemperatureMax to catch a CPU approaching a thermal limit on a Cisco UCS blade.
